APS Air Bag Conversion Kit

The patented ATC Air Technology Conversion Kit will extend the life of your old dock leveler and make it more efficient while lowering your operating costs.

The ATC Kit converts levelers of most major manufacturers and can be installed easily. In addition, ATC’s technology is proven safe. The airbag lifting module is made of tough, PVC-coated polyester fibers that operate without loss of performance in temperatures from -65F to +200F, even if the bag is punctured. Standard features include push-button station, high-visibility maintenance strut, low-pressure fan motor, removable lifting bag assembly, and lip extension mechanism.

 APS Flexback Panel

The FLEX-BACK™ Panel is the answer to common lower door panel damage, which is one of the most frequent and costly maintenance problems in today’s busy warehouses. The FLEX-BACK panel is constructed from a high-impact polymer skin and flexible tube frame which allows the panel to flex upon impact and return to its normal operating position. This durability helps reduce door maintenance costs and helps eliminate damage to bottom door panels. The FLEX-BACK uses standard door hardware and replaces most standard sectional door panels easily. The insulated panel also provides an exceptional thermal seal to save on energy costs.
